FERRAMENTAS LINUX: Critical GIMP Vulnerability CVE-2022-30067: Analysis, Mitigation, and Enterprise Security Implications

sexta-feira, 2 de janeiro de 2026

Critical GIMP Vulnerability CVE-2022-30067: Analysis, Mitigation, and Enterprise Security Implications

 


Critical security update for GIMP users: CVE-2022-30067 exposed systems to arbitrary code execution via maliciously crafted XCF files. This in-depth analysis details the vulnerability, its impact on Linux and enterprise environments, and provides actionable patching and mitigation strategies to ensure digital asset security.

A recently patched flaw in the GNU Image Manipulation Program (GIMP) serves as a stark reminder that even trusted creative software can become a vector for cyber attacks. Designated as CVE-2022-30067, this high-severity vulnerability in the popular open-source image editor allowed for arbitrary code execution, potentially compromising entire systems. 

For digital artists, graphic designers, and the enterprise environments they operate within, understanding this exploit is not merely academic—it's a crucial component of modern cybersecurity hygiene

Could your creative suite be the weakest link in your organization's security posture?

This comprehensive analysis delves into the technical specifics of the GIMP DLA-4431-1 advisory, providing actionable intelligence for IT administrators, security professionals, and informed users. 

We will dissect the exploit mechanism, outline precise remediation steps, and explore the broader implications for software supply chain security and digital asset management.

Technical Breakdown of the GIMP XCF File Handling Vulnerability (H2)

The core of CVE-2022-30067 resided in GIMP's processing of its native XCF file format. XCF files are complex containers that store image data, layers, paths, and other project metadata. The vulnerability was a classic case of improper input validation within the file parsing routines.

  • Exploit Vector: A threat actor could craft a malicious XCF file designed to trigger a heap-based buffer overflow during the decompression phase.

  • Attack Mechanism: When a user opened this specially crafted file, the flawed code would allow data to overwrite critical memory segments. A sophisticated attacker could structure this data to execute their own code with the privileges of the user running GIMP.

  • Primary Risk: Arbitrary Code Execution (ACE). This is one of the most severe classifications in the Common Vulnerability Scoring System (CVSS), as it grants an attacker a foothold on the target machine.

What does this mean in practice? Imagine a graphic designer receives a "project brief" or "asset pack" from an untrusted source. Opening a single image file could silently install malware, exfiltrate sensitive data, or move laterally across a network. 

This underscores the critical need for proactive vulnerability management even in non-traditional software.

Immediate Patching and Mitigation Strategies for Linux Systems (H2)

The primary and most effective mitigation is immediate patching. The GIMP maintainers and Linux distribution security teams acted swiftly to release corrected packages.

Recommended Action Steps: (H3)

  1. Update Immediately: Use your system's package manager to install the latest GIMP version.

    • For Debian-based systems (e.g., Ubuntu): sudo apt update && sudo apt upgrade gimp

    • For Red Hat-based systems (e.g., Fedora, RHEL): sudo dnf update gimp

  2. Verify the Patch: Confirm that your installed GIMP version is no longer vulnerable. The patched versions were typically 2.10.30-2+deb11u2 for Debian 11 and corresponding builds for other distributions.

  3. Enterprise Deployment: For sysadmins managing fleets, utilize your centralized patch management solution (e.g., Red Hat Satellite, Ubuntu Landscape, Ansible) to push this update as a high-priority fix.

Compensating Controls for Unpatched Systems: (H3)

If patching cannot be performed immediately, implement these network security and user behavior controls:

  • Restrict File Sources: Enforce policy that XCF files should only be opened from trusted, internal network shares or verified collaborators.

  • Principle of Least Privilege: Ensure users run GIMP with standard user accounts, not administrative privileges, to limit the potential damage of successful exploitation.

  • Endpoint Detection & Response (EDR): Configure your EDR tools to flag suspicious processes spawned from gimp or attempts to modify critical system files.

Broader Implications for Software Security and Enterprise Risk (H2)

While patching this specific CVE (Common Vulnerabilities and Exposures) is straightforward, the incident highlights larger trends in the cybersecurity threat landscape.

The Expanding Attack Surface of Creative Software: Tools like GIMP, Blender, and Audacity are foundational to digital content creation. Their complexity makes them fertile ground for memory corruption vulnerabilities. 

Enterprises must integrate these applications into their Software Asset Management (SAM) and vulnerability scanning programs, not just traditional office productivity suites.

Open-Source Security and Dependencies: GIMP is built upon numerous libraries (e.g., GTK, GLib). A vulnerability in any underlying dependency can cascade upwards. This reinforces the necessity of Software Composition Analysis (SCA) tools to map and secure the entire software supply chain.

The Human Firewall is Critical: The initial attack vector—opening a malicious file—relies on social engineering. Regular security awareness training must include creatives and knowledge workers who handle multimedia files, teaching them to verify sources and report suspicious attachments.

Frequently Asked Questions (FAQ) (H2)

Q1: What is CVE-2022-30067, and why was it critical?

A: CVE-2022-30067 was a high-severity heap buffer overflow vulnerability in GIMP's XCF file parser. Its criticality stemmed from its ability to allow arbitrary code execution, enabling attackers to take control of a user's system by tricking them into opening a malicious image file.

Q2: I use GIMP on Windows or macOS. Was I affected?

A: Yes, the vulnerability was in GIMP's core code. However, the advisory cited (DLA-4431-1) was specifically for Debian Linux. Users on all platforms must ensure they are running GIMP version 2.10.30 or later, which includes the fix. Always obtain software from the official GIMP website or trusted distributors.

Q3: How can I check if my Linux system has been patched?

A: You can use the command apt show gimp on Debian/Ubuntu or rpm -q gimp on RHEL/Fedora to check the installed version. Compare it against the patched version noted in your distribution's security advisory.

Q4: Are there any indicators of compromise (IOCs) for this vulnerability?

A: While specific IOCs depend on the attacker's payload, monitor for unusual processes launched from GIMP, unexpected network connections from a user's workstation, or unauthorized file modifications. EDR logs are crucial for this forensic analysis.

Q5: What is the long-term lesson for organizations from this vulnerability?

A: It demonstrates that application security must encompass all user-facing software. A holistic vulnerability management program that includes patch prioritization, user training, and layered defensive controls (like EDR and network segmentation) is essential to mitigate risks from such exploits.

Conclusion and Proactive Next Steps

The resolution of CVE-2022-30067 is a testament to the responsive nature of the open-source security community. 

However, it should serve as a catalyst for organizations to audit their exposure. Proactive security is no longer optional.

Your Actionable Checklist:

  1. Verify all systems running GIMP are patched.

  2. Integrate creative and development tools into your formal vulnerability management framework.

  3. Reinforce training for staff on the risks of untrusted file formats.

  4. Review your incident response plan to ensure it covers compromises originating from seemingly benign applications like image editors.

Staying informed is your first line of defense. Subscribe to security advisories from your Linux distribution vendor and monitor authoritative sources like the National Vulnerability Database (NVD) to maintain a robust security posture in an evolving digital landscape.

Nenhum comentário:

Postar um comentário